The 2024 IRONMAN 70.3 St. George offers Age Group Qualifying slots to the 2024 VinFast IRONMAN 70.3 World Championship on 14 & 15 December 2024 in TaupĹŤ, New Zealand. This event also offers 2024 VinFast IRONMAN World Championship, Nice, France, slots to the Top 5 Placed Women in each age group category.

On May 7, 2022, the Ironman World Championship will be contested outside of Hawaii for the first time in the event’s history. But it won’t be a Kona knockoff or a mini-version of the Hawaii race. It will be entirely its own thing, said Ironman St. George race director Judy Stowers. And it will be better for it.

It's here that the real work begins. The remaining 86 miles of the bike course consist of two loops over a mountain pass. Each loop has about two miles of flat, followed by 30 miles of steady climbing, culminating with 14 miles of very steep downhill. You'll climb somewhere between 6,000 and 7,000 feet for the day.
